Providence Health & Servicesposted 2 days ago
$36 - $89/Yr
Full-time • Entry Level
Portland, OR
Hospitals

About the position

The IS Software Engineer is responsible for the end-to-end development and quality of solutions and services that delight caregivers and add strategic value to PSJH. They evaluate requirements, estimate costs, and design and implement solutions and services. They define and implement the quality criteria for their solutions and services, using measurements and insights to understand and validate the quality of experience for caregivers. They manage and improve the engineering process, manage risks, dependencies and compromises, and integrate software into broader ecosystems and/or solutions and services.

Responsibilities

  • Evaluate requirements, estimate costs, and design and implement solutions and services.
  • Define and implement the quality criteria for solutions and services.
  • Use measurements and insights to understand and validate the quality of experience for caregivers.
  • Manage and improve the engineering process.
  • Manage risks, dependencies, and compromises.
  • Integrate software into broader ecosystems and/or solutions and services.

Requirements

  • Bachelor's Degree in Computer Engineering, Computer Science, Mathematics, Engineering, or a combination of equivalent education and experience.
  • 2 or more years of related experience.
  • Experience with object-oriented programming in C#, Java, Python or equivalent.
  • Experience with source code control systems such as Git.
  • SQL integration development experience using SQL/NoSQL.
  • Experience with agile methodologies and tools such as Azure Devops, TFS, and Jira.
  • Proven track record of working both independently and collaboratively as part of a multi-disciplined team.
  • Experience designing and successfully implementing a mid-sized project.

Nice-to-haves

  • Experience in a healthcare setting.
  • 2 or more years of software engineering experience.
  • 1 or more years of EPIC experience.

Benefits

  • Best-in-class benefits designed to support you and your family in staying well.
  • Opportunities for professional growth.
  • Financial security support.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service